Is Zeros GmbH approved for testing railway components?

Yes. The NDT inspection body of Zeros GmbH is confirmed by the inspection body of DB Systemtechnik as conforming to DIN 27201-7 (non-destructive testing of rail vehicles) – registration number DB-52-AB-319-1-22, listed in the DGZfP register until 28 February 2027. The recognition covers five methods: visual testing (VT), magnetic particle testing (MT), ultrasonic testing (UT), penetrant testing (PT) and radiographic testing (RT) – on railway components such as wheelset axles (hollow and solid), wheels, bogie frames, draw hooks and buffers. The testing personnel is certified according to DIN EN ISO 9712 in the railway industry sector; Zeros is also a full member of the German Railway Industry Association (VDB).
